San Antonio city officials have been forced to remove rainbow-painted crosswalks from two downtown intersections following Gov. Greg Abbott's order to eliminate political ideologies from Texas streets.
The city had sought an exemption from the Texas Department of Transportation (TxDOT) in November, but was unable to meet the requirement for a "signed and sealed document by an engineer," according to Councilwoman Sukh Kaur.
The crosswalks in San Antonio were installed in the city's Pride district in 2018. No increase in accidents at the intersection has been reported, and there is no evidence that rainbow crosswalks cause more accidents.
